Ped/Auto According to the latest national statistics, pedestrian fatalities represent 18% of all vehicular fatalities. Over 7,000 pedestrians are killed in traffic crashes, while 68,000 pedestrians are injured nationwide. The investigation of pedestrian collisions presents special considerations, probably more so than vehicle vs. vehicle collisions. This course is designed to give students a thorough understanding of scene evidence assessment and documentation, as well as the application of specialized pedestrian equations. This course features simulated impacts that allow the students to apply learned methodologies for calculating vehicle impact speeds. Topics: Medical and Vehicle Terminology The Pedestrian, Driver and Environmental Relationship The Crash Scene Pedestrian Crash Analysis Introduction to Formulas Crash Tests and Exercises Temple Police Department, 209 E. Crush Energy This course explains the fundamentals of crush energy and the important role it plays in collision reconstruction. More specifically, students learn about the critical role of energy balance as it applies to a thorough investigation. Proper protocol for obtaining crush measurements is explained as well as how to accurately determine crush coefficients. Topics: Fundamental Concepts Velocity/time diagrams Force, work and energy analysis Coefficient of restitution and crush energy Crush measurement, crush energy and impact speed analysis Damage Classification Motion analysis Temple Police Department, 209 E.
